About

Meri Sukiasyan Ponist is an immigration attorney with 20 years of legal experience, practicing at Law Office of Meri S. Ponist in New York, NY. He earned a J.D. from State University of Armenia Law Faculty in 1993 and a J.D. from Suny Buffalo Law School in 2004. He has been admitted to the New York Bar since 2005. His practice encompasses immigration and divorce and separation,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. In addition to English, he is proficient in Armenian and Russian. Mr. Ponist offers free initial consultations, making legal representation more accessible to those in need.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
